You are making me hungry!! My favorite is the cuban sandwich..Lots of these here in South Fla. You use fresh cuban bread of course, if no avail in your area, use any soft hogie roll, Paper thin slices of pork and prosciutto ham, swiss or baby swiss cheese thin sliced pickles and cuban (yellow) mayo. I usually toast it on grill with a heavy weight on top as my sandwich maker broke!! In any case try it,,its yummy. If you want receipe for cuban mayo, let me know..Joyce
